CMOTDibbler · 21/02/2020 19:19

I have a DryRobe (am an open water swimmer), and much as it is fantastic for puppy night trips to the garden as I can pull it on as I run down the stairs and be warm, waterproof and decent, its not something I'd wear to walk the dog as the wind goes up the sleeves and it is too flappy. Unless you have another need for it, spend the money on a Stadium Squall from Lands End which is warm, waterproof and covers most of you
